With just five days remaining until the Premier League season kicks off, anticipation is reaching fever pitch. Arsenal, fresh off a thrilling title race last year, will be looking to build on their momentum and challenge for the top spot once again.
As the countdown begins, it’s worth noting a fascinating statistic that highlights Arsenal’s relentless pursuit of victory in the 2023-24 season. The Gunners drew fewer games than any other team in the league – a mere five – showcasing their consistent drive for three points in every match.
This relentless approach played a crucial role in their title challenge, as they consistently pushed Manchester City to the limit. As the new season approaches, Arsenal will be looking to replicate that determination, aiming for a strong start against Wolverhampton Wanderers on Saturday, August 17th.
